Milk per animal in Panama
Panama: Milk per animal was 1,257 kilograms per animal in 2024. β² Rising
Milk per animal in Panama, 1961β2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(2025) β with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in kilograms per animal.
Analysis
Panama recorded 1,257 kilograms per animal for milk per animal in 2024.
That represents a change of down 0.7% on the previous year and down 10.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, milk per animal in Panama peaked at 1,480 kilograms per animal in 2020 and was at its lowest, 839.79 kilograms per animal, in 1964.
Panama ranks 86th of 191 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 903.77 kilograms per animal | 839.79 kilograms per animal | 993.92 kilograms per animal | 9 |
| 1970s | 975.63 kilograms per animal | 936.56 kilograms per animal | 1,005 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 1980s | 1,037 kilograms per animal | 975.74 kilograms per animal | 1,096 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 1990s | 1,225 kilograms per animal | 1,118 kilograms per animal | 1,390 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 2000s | 1,182 kilograms per animal | 1,079 kilograms per animal | 1,219 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 2010s | 1,290 kilograms per animal | 1,056 kilograms per animal | 1,459 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 2020s | 1,325 kilograms per animal | 1,257 kilograms per animal | 1,480 kilograms per animal | 5 |

About this data
Average annual milk production per animal. Values are estimated by dividing the production of milk (from cattle, sheep, goats, and other animals) by the number of animals used for milk production.
